Description/Abstract
A high-performance single-mode optical time-domain reflectometer (OTDR) is described. Dynamic ranges of 30dB and 41dB one-way are achieved using laser diode and Nd:YAG laser sources respectively. A new OTDR technique allows absolute splice-loss measurements as well as active splice alignment to be performed from one cable end only.
